Express our Indignation over the interruption of Lithuanias sovereign function as a result of the military occupation of our homeland by the Soviet Union on June 15. Gravely concerned with the present plight of Sovietoccupied Lithuania and animated by a spirit of solidarity we. the members and friends of the Lithuanian ethnic community of New Jersey. Do hereby protest Soviet Russias aggression and the following crimes perpetrated by the Soviets in occupied Lithuania: (1) murder and deportation of more than 400.000 Lithuanian citizens to concentration camps in Siberia and other areas of Soviet Russia for slave labor. (2) colonization of Lithuania by importation of Russians. most of whom are Communists or undesirables. (3) persecution of the faithful. restriction of religious practices. closing of houses of worship. (4) distortion of Lithuanian culture by efforts to transform into a SovietRussian culture and continuous denial of creative freedom. We demand that Soviet Russia Immediately withdraw from Lithuania and its sister states of Estonia and Latvia. its armed forces. administrative apparatus. and the Imported Communist "colons". letting the Baltic States of Estonia. Latvia. and Lithuania freely exercise their sovereign rights to selfdetermination.
